http://www.ebay.com/itm/Monster-Miles-Davis-Trumpet-Earphones-with-ControlTalk-/120929597094?pt=US_Headphones&hash=item1c27f736a6That is a very good deal if you get the full Monster lifetime warranty. Only thing wrong it says is blemished packaging. And it is from Monster (checked seller). I have a pair and really love the sound, much more than any other Monster IEM I have heard.
I checked the ebay site and it appears the Monster lifetime warranty is in effect (it says the warranty is whatever the cards in the package say). I know when they sell in their bargain site at monstercable.com, they limit the warranties to 90 days, which to me might still be worth the risk. But it's not clear on ebay. I would say it will stand up as a legit purchase for the Monster lifetime warranty. That means, if it fails you get replacements indefinitely. If you break it, crush it or step on it, the Monster warranty was you get a "one time" replacement too (in other words, it it's non-functional and its your fault). With Monster's spotty QC track record, the warranty is important.
